Kingston Ghost & Mystery Trolley Tour
Uncover the chilling secrets of Kingston's past on the Ghost & Mystery Trolley Tour. This 90-minute evening excursion takes you off the beaten path to explore haunted landmarks and notorious neighborhoods. Hear spooky stories and local legends from engaging guides as you ride past infamous sites like Kingston Penitentiary and the eerie Rockwood Asylum. Experience the darker side of Canada's first capital in style.

Know Before You Go
- Tickets: $$ – Get tickets
- Parking: Parking for cars is not provided on site, but is available at several downtown Kingston city lots all within walking distance to your departure point (parking fees are extra). We recommend the City of Kingston Parking lots nearby, which are the best value. The Hanson Memorial Parking Garage at 105 Brock St. is the closest and most convenient lot to our location.
- Accessibility: The tour is listed as accessible. Visit their accessibility page for more details.
- Pets: No pets allowed (service animals welcome)
Tips & Advice
- Arrive at least 15 minutes before your scheduled departure time to ensure you don't miss the trolley, as late arrivals cannot be accommodated.
- Consider purchasing a K-Pass to bundle your trolley tour with other Kingston attractions for potential savings.
- While the tour operates rain or shine, it's advisable to check the weather and dress in layers with comfortable shoes, as per the 'What to Bring' suggestions.
- Reservations are highly recommended, especially during peak season or holiday weekends, as tours can sell out in advance.
- If you need to change your reservation, contact them at least 24 hours in advance by phone to reschedule or receive a future credit.
